The Role Reporting into the CFO, this is a broad, high-impact role spanning financial accounting, management reporting, FP&A, treasury, and wider finance transformation. You will play a central role in bringing finance fully in-house, building processes and controls from the ground up, and creating the reporting and commercial insight needed to support the next phase of growth.

You will also partner closely with the CFO on strategic finance priorities, including lender reporting, cashflow management, and preparations for future refinancing activity.

Key Responsibilities

  • Own the monthly management accounts process end-to-end, ensuring accurate and timely delivery of P&L, balance sheet, and working capital reporting.
  • Lead the year-end process, coordinating statutory accounts preparation and managing the external audit process.
  • Build and strengthen the financial control environment, including reconciliations, accruals, revenue recognition, and process discipline.
  • Develop and lead the budgeting, forecasting, and reforecasting cycle, partnering with operational and commercial stakeholders.
  • Take ownership of the rolling cashflow forecast and working capital model, identifying key risks and opportunities.
  • Build financial models and analysis to support commercial decision-making, including pricing, profitability, resource planning, and scenario analysis.
  • Support the CFO on strategic finance projects, financing preparation, lender reporting, and covenant tracking.
  • Oversee tax compliance across VAT, payroll tax, and corporation tax, working with external advisors where appropriate.
  • Lead and develop the existing finance team, while helping shape the future structure and capability of the function.
  • Drive continuous improvement across finance processes, systems, and reporting, embedding scalable ways of working across the business.
